The pre Qin fables of China and the ancient Greek "Aesop’s Fables" constitute a flower stalk flowers, in the fable literature history. They are in full bloom at the same time of Axial Period, in the process of human spiritual life. Their fragrance affects the whole fables world between East and West. The pre Qin fables and "Aesop’s Fables" works as source of fable between East and West culture system, they are also the most representative works. As soon as they are produced, they quickly push the fable style to maturity, and their creation rules become the two civilization circle immortal fable literature tradition inheritance. This paper tries to use the method of comparative literature parallel research, to make a comparative study of the pre Qin fables and "Aesop’s Fables", in order to find the inherent law.The first chapter of this paper is the introduction part. Starting from the concept of "Axis Period" to introduce the object of comparative study: Chinese pre Qin fables and the ancient Greek "Aesop’s Fables". and introduced the development history of the early Chinese and Western fable; and their basic situation, basic characteristics; and the research status, research problems and research methods of this paper.The second chapter discusses the essence and basis mode of pre Qin fables and "Aesop’s Fables".They have common basic mode, namely "Story + meaning" mode and the same pattern of thinking to build the model of the foundation; the inner logic of the rational connection and transformation of the sense chain; and their deep culture structure, such as like / abstract, emotional / rational, the original / civilization, natural / cultural. And also includes the relationship between them and the more ancient mythology rituals.The third chapter focuses on the content of Chinese and Western fable. Mainly including the similarities and differences between the image of the role of the pre Qin fables and Aesop’s fables in shaping the story selected stories and their causes. And the social factors of the different choice tendency of the stories meaning.The fourth chapter mainly describes the form of Chinese and Western fable and the external problems. Including differences of pre Qin fables and Aesop’s Fables of different creative subject, text writing style,the attribute and independence of the style of writing.The fifth chapter discusses the aesthetic and cultural functions of Chinese and Western fable. Mainly includes the rebellious problem of pre Qin fables and "Aesop’s Fables" in the lyric and narrative aspect; both of the two have the rhetorical function and the common use of metaphor, imitating, exaggerated artistic technique; the aesthetic effect of irony, humorous and witty; as well as four kinds of cultural functions of education, carrier, communication and aesthetics.The conclusion part summarize the problems which discovered and solved in this research project and its significance. Elucidate the fable literature in heterogeneous cultural space, the Chinese pre Qin fables and the ancient Greek "Aesop’s Fables", which embodies the common internal rules. In the end, appealing we should against cultural chauvinism, seek common ground, to maintain diversity of the world literature ecologyand.
